什么是重組蛋白?

重組蛋白是一種可操縱的蛋白質(zhì)形式,可以通過多種方式產(chǎn)生大量蛋白質(zhì)、修改基因序列和制造有用的商業(yè)產(chǎn)品。重組蛋白的技術(shù)資源在重組蛋白的開發(fā)過程中,除了表達系統(tǒng)之外,還面臨著一系列令人困惑的選擇,如表達載體的選擇、表達蛋白的長度(全長或部分)、是否帶標簽等。在生產(chǎn)重組蛋白時,你必須做出很多決定。如果你選擇的明智,你將獲得高質(zhì)量的重組蛋白,后續(xù)的實驗更有可能成功。但是如果你做了錯誤的決定,你可能得不到你所需要的重組蛋白或者重組蛋白的質(zhì)量和純度不符合要求。在這里,來自CUSABIO的蛋白表達工程師根據(jù)他們開發(fā)重組蛋白的經(jīng)驗總結(jié)出了幾個有用的提示,可以幫助你做出明智的決策。

第二條:如何選擇合適的表達載體?

表達載體是一種DNA分子,它攜帶特定的基因進入宿主細胞,并利用細胞的蛋白質(zhì)合成機制來產(chǎn)生由該基因編碼的蛋白質(zhì)。表達載體可使外源基因在宿主細胞中高效表達,經(jīng)過多年的發(fā)展,表達載體已成為一種成熟而受歡迎的生物技術(shù)。在重組蛋白生產(chǎn)過程中是一種基本成分。正如標題所示,本文主要總結(jié)了幾個有用的技巧來選擇合適的表達載體。
